Hearing your baby say their first word is very exciting. And the first words are often “mama” or “papa”. But when encouraging your baby to talk, be aware that maybe their fur siblings will get there first.
In this hilarious video, mom, Andrea Diaz-Giovanini, offers her nine-month-old son, Sam, a reward if he could say the word “mama”. And Sam started forming the words with his mouth, but could just not get the word out of his mouth.
Sitting next to Sam, was his pooch brother, Patch. Who was just as eager for the reward as Sam was. He was murmuring and crying with excitement for the treat. He would not take his eyes off Andrea, hoping he would get some.
Then Patch got really excited and while murmuring, he began saying “mama” over and over again. And how accurate it sounds.
Everyone found this to be very amusing and started laughing. Except for poor Sam, who realized that Patch was getting more attention than he was. So he did what every baby would do, and tried to move Patch out of the way.
Eventually, they both got the reward that they deserve. But it still makes for a very cute and funny video. Both Sam and Patch probably now compete against each other to say the word “mama” first to get a delicious treat.
Patch, who is a trained miniature Australian Shepard Dog, came to the family to help in the recovery process of the family’s grandmother after she suffered a brain injury in a car accident. And if she feels she might be having a seizure, Patch would alert another family member.
He is very intelligent and this makes him a very valuable family member and an entertaining one when he speaks.
